Transaction 3b746044c15bb7251f9bbface850caee281f254b0ed7e3001abcfd2c7be68c83
1 Input
1 Output
-
3b746044c15bb7251f9bbface850caee281f254b0ed7e3001abcfd2c7be68c83:0
- value
- 40564783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20ceaca1ad6d3fd70fa00c6e2dd7a707529c9837 OP_EQUAL
- address
- 34gV8ffF1oroGtzxxPX9Yo9CAcaeyrRh94